CVE-2025-49492 is an out-of-bounds write vulnerability in the ASR180x LTE-telephony module (specifically in apps/atcmd_server/src/dev_api.C) that may cause a buffer underrun condition. It affects ASR Micro's Falcon_Linux, Kestrel, and Lapwing_Linux operating systems in all versions prior to v1536. The vulnerability was published on July 1, 2025, and carries a CVSS v3.1 base score of 9.8 (Critical) per NVD, reflecting unauthenticated remote exploitability with no user interaction required (ASR PSIRT).
The vulnerability is classified as CWE-787 (Out-of-bounds Write) and resides in the AT command server component of the ASR180x LTE-telephony stack, specifically in the source file apps/atcmd_server/src/dev_api.C. An attacker can trigger a buffer underrun by sending maliciously crafted network input to the affected component, causing writes to memory locations outside the intended buffer boundaries. No authentication or user interaction is required, and attack complexity is low, making this exploitable by any network-accessible attacker (ASR PSIRT).
Successful exploitation of this vulnerability can result in complete compromise of the affected device, with high impact to confidentiality, integrity, and availability. An unauthenticated remote attacker could achieve arbitrary code execution, manipulate system data, or cause a denial-of-service condition on affected LTE modem/telephony platforms. Given the embedded/IoT nature of the ASR180x chipset, exploitation could affect cellular connectivity and potentially enable persistent access to the underlying system (ASR PSIRT).
As of the time of publication, there is no known public proof-of-concept exploit and no evidence of active in-the-wild exploitation. The EPSS score is approximately 0.037%, indicating a currently low probability of exploitation in the near term. The vulnerability has not been added to the CISA Known Exploited Vulnerabilities (KEV) catalog. However, the critical CVSS score and unauthenticated network attack vector make it a high-priority patching target (ASR PSIRT).
ASR Micro has released a patch addressing this vulnerability. Affected users should update all impacted platforms — Falcon_Linux, Kestrel, and Lapwing_Linux — to version v1536 or later. No specific workarounds have been publicly documented; upgrading to the patched firmware version is the recommended and primary remediation action. Administrators should monitor affected systems for anomalous behavior while updates are being deployed (ASR PSIRT).
The vulnerability received routine aggregation coverage from vulnerability tracking platforms including Vulners, VulDB, CIRCL, and CVEFeed shortly after its July 1, 2025 publication. It was also referenced in CISA's weekly vulnerability bulletin for the week of June 30, 2025. No notable independent researcher commentary or significant media coverage has been identified beyond standard automated vulnerability feeds (CISA Bulletin).
